Detailed Explanation of Hong Kong Egg Freezing Costs in 2026
Egg freezing technology offers an important option for women who wish to delay childbearing. The cost of egg freezing in Hong Kong in 2026 mainly includes the following parts:
Medical examination fees: Before egg freezing, a comprehensive physical examination is required, including hormone level testing, ovarian function assessment, and infectious disease screening. This part of the cost is approximately between HKD 8,000 and HKD 15,000.
Ovarian stimulation medication costs: The cost of ovarian stimulation medications varies depending on the brand, dosage, and individual response. Imported medications are more expensive, while domestic medications are relatively economical. In 2026, the cost of ovarian stimulation medications in Hong Kong is generally between HKD 25,000 and HKD 50,000.
Egg retrieval surgery fees: The egg retrieval procedure is performed under anesthesia and includes operating room fees, anesthesia fees, and surgeon fees. In 2026, the cost of egg retrieval surgery in Hong Kong is approximately between HKD 30,000 and HKD 50,000.
Egg freezing and storage fees: After retrieval, mature eggs undergo vitrification and are stored in liquid nitrogen tanks. The initial freezing fee includes the freezing technique and the first year's storage fee, approximately between HKD 15,000 and HKD 25,000. Subsequent annual storage fees are approximately between HKD 5,000 and HKD 8,000.
Overall, the total cost for one complete egg freezing cycle in Hong Kong in 2026 is approximately between HKD 80,000 and HKD 150,000. The specific cost varies depending on individual health conditions, the chosen fertility center, and the response to medications.

Key Factors Influencing Hong Kong Egg Freezing and Surrogacy Costs
Individual health status is one of the core factors affecting costs. The younger the age and the better the ovarian function, the lower the dosage of ovarian stimulation medications required, the higher the egg retrieval success rate, and the overall cost will be correspondingly lower. If there are special conditions such as polycystic ovary syndrome or premature ovarian failure, more medications and medical interventions may be needed, increasing the cost.
The technical level and fee standards of the chosen fertility center directly affect the total cost. In 2026, fertility centers in Hong Kong differ in equipment, technology, and expert teams, and their pricing strategies also vary. Choosing a center with strong technical capabilities and high success rates may have slightly higher initial costs, but it offers better value for money in terms of success rate and safety.
The use of embryo genetic screening technology adds extra costs. If clients choose to undergo preimplantation genetic testing, including chromosome screening and single-gene disease testing, the cost increases by HKD 30,000 to HKD 80,000. This technology can significantly improve implantation success rates and reduce the risk of miscarriage, making it particularly important for individuals with a genetic history or advanced age.
